The reports of his death are greatly exaggerated

al-Reuters has the story of the non-story:
An Internet report claiming that Apple chief executive Steve Jobs has had a heart attack is not true, the company said on Friday. Responding to a report in iReport, a citizen journalist web site owned and operated by Time Warner's CNN, Apple spokesman Steve Dowling told Reuters by email: "It is not true."
The report claimed Jobs was rushed to the emergency room after suffering "a major heart attack."
Asked for for further details about the status of Jobs' health, Dowling repeated: "The story is not true."
The report has since been removed from iReport. A CNN spokesman was not immediately available for comment.
